Which Sized Dumpster Should I Rent for My Wheeling Project?

10 Yard Dumpster

10 yard dumpster in Wheeling

10 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 4 pick-up trucks of waste material. These dumpsters are most often used for smaller projects such as garage/basement clean outs, small bathroom remodels, kitchen remodels, small roof replacements up to 1500 sq ft or a small deck removal up to 500 sq ft.

20 Yard Dumpster

20 yard dumpster in Wheeling

20 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 8 pick-up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for projects like flooring or carpet removal for a large house, roof replacements up to 3,000 sq ft, deck removal up to 400 sq ft, or large garage/basement clean outs.

30 Yard Dumpster

30 yard dumpster in Wheeling

30 yard roll off dumpsters hold about 12 pick up trucks of waste material. They are most often used for projects like new home constructions, large home additions, siding or window replacements for a small to medium sized house, or garage/basement demolition.

40 Yard Dumpster

40 yard dumpster in Wheeling

40 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 16 pick up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for large projects like commercial clean outs, window replacement or siding for a large home, large home renovations, large construction projects, or large commercial roofing projects.

Common Projects and Dumpster Sizes Needed to Complete Them

General Garbage Removal or Remodeling Projects: Each person’s task is unique, but in general a 20 cubic yard dumpster is sufficient for a single room remodel or cleanup. A 20 cubic yard dumpster rental will handle about 6 truckloads of waste, unless you have bigger items like appliances you’re getting rid of.

Multi-Room Contracting Jobs: When remodeling several rooms in your home or having contracting work performed a 30 cubic yard dumpster is typically an ideal option. This size will make certain you don’t have to worry about the dumpster having to be unloaded and returned, but rather it would only take just one trip.

One Room Storage Area Cleanup: Cleaning out unwanted items or debris from your storage areas is a great way to free up more room or space in your home. For the average home storage area, a simple 10 or 15 cubic yard dumpster is ideal. If you have big items, such as appliances, you may want a 20 yarder just to be on the safe side.

Full Home Cleanup Projects: For stuff such as furniture or large appliances that you’re cleaning out of your home, a 15-20 cubic yard dumpster would be best for the typical house. For much larger homes, however, a 30 cubic yard dumpster would be a better choice since it would amount to around 9 regular truckloads of waste.

Landscaping Projects: Landscaping, yard or gardening work normally only produce a small amount of waste that will not take up a significant amount of space in a dumpster. Therefore, the average yard job will only require a 10 to 15 cubic yard dumpster, unless you are planning on disposing of numerous tree branches or full shrubbery.

Construction Work: For large renovation, home improvement or construction undertakings a large dumpster size, such as a 40 cubic yard option, would be perfect. Anytime you count on a large amount of debris to be produced by your job, having a larger sized dumpster is the best bet. Heavy waste objects, such as concrete or asphalt, will demand a specific heavy-duty dumpster.

How Much Do Wheeling Dumpster Rentals Cost?

Generally,you can expect to pay around $175 to $1,000 for a roll-off container rental in Wheeling. Dumpsters for rent in Wheeling can vary in price based on many things.

One of the biggest factors you need to think about is the size of the roll off dumpster. You must plan which type of bin to get so you can avoid paying extra rental fees. For small types of bins, you can expect to pay more or less $200. If you require a larger dumpster, you may spend close to $1000. Most rental services include the travel costs into the final bill without you even knowing. Always double check the final rates with the company before handing over payment.

One of the most common questions we hear is how is a dumpster rental rate determined? The primary way in which dumpster rental rates are worked out is by the size/volume of the container. The larger and more volume the dumpster holds, the higher rate it will have. The next factor in cost is how long, or how many days, you’ll need your dumpster rental for. Other than those two points, the types of materials you’ll be putting in the dumpster may also have an effect on price. Items with a lot of weight to them, like concrete, bricks or roofing shingles, may call for a special type of dumpster that can handle these heavy loads. It’s important to take this into consideration, as you may not end up filling your dumpster to the top, but you could still go over its weight capacity depending on the type of waste material you’re disposing of.

Below are some of the typical factors that might effect the price of renting a dumpster:

– How heavy the waste items are.
– Waste that must be specifically disposed of.
– Possible landfill fees for large items such as mattresses or big appliances.
– Charges for exceeding the dumpster’s weight limitation.
– Potentially needing to obtain municipal permits for your area.
– Extending the initial period of rental for the dumpster.

Does Wheeling Require a Permit for Dumpster Rentals and Placement?

The majority of of the time clients won’t have to get worried about obtaining a permit for their dumpster rental in the Wheeling area. In general, a permit won’t be required as long as you are able to place the dumpster on your own private property, such as your driveway or other area you own. Only when you find yourself wanting to place the dumpster on public property, such as sidewalks or parking areas on the side of the road, that certain municipalities require permits issued.

The easiest way to avoid acquiring a permit is to just rent a dumpster that is a size appropriate for your driveway or property. This will ensure that you can avoid placing it on public property and perhaps having to acquire a permit. You can also check with the local Wheeling Public Works Department prior to rental. Most areas do not demand a permit as long as the dumpster rental will not be placed on public property or get in the way of public access. If you do end up requiring a permit it’s as easy as contacting the local Wheeling Public Works department or going to their website and filling out the correct forms.
